Telangana Hyderabad Metro Rail may enhance services in view of Ganesh festival

SIBY JEYYA
Hyderabad Metro rail Limited (HMRL) may offer extra trains in honour of the Ganesh festival. Additionally, it is anticipated to improve security protocols for the city event. On the day of the immersion, hyderabad Metro rail services are expected to be extended due to the high volume of pilgrims visiting the well-known Khairatabad Ganesh pandal. As was the case last year, it is anticipated that the services will be offered until one in the morning.
In order to better serve the people during the event, additional ticket booths have been set up for hyderabad Metro rail users. In order to maintain safety, more security officers are anticipated to be stationed at the Khairatabad Metro station. Hyderabad's Ganesh festival is set to start on september 18 and extensive preparations are already in place. For the installation of Ganesh idols and processions in hyderabad and other telangana districts, the police recently issued an invitation for applications.
The hyderabad police have also made the decision to prohibit the lighting of fireworks in public areas beginning on september 18 at six in the morning. The celebration was previously designated a holiday by the telangana government on september 18 under the heading of "General Holidays."

Applicants must include information on the application form, including their name, address, association name, and installation information. The height of the idol, the date of immersion, and the manner of transportation must all be included in the installation information.
